    • Device and method for building a radial tire. The device includes a first drum device for building a belt package and a transfer device for transferring the belt package from the first drum device to a second drum device having arranged thereon a carcass tube from at least one airtight inner layer, a carcass play and two bead cores with core profiles. The second drum device is arranged between core clamping devices and is structured and arranged to join the carcass tube and the belt package during expansion of the second drum device. The belt package is contoured or shaped by deformation via the second drum device.     • A method that can be used in the automated construction of a vehicle tire, using butt spliced tire components consisting of material webs, for example textile cords or steel cords that are embedded in a rubber mixture, to produce a carcass insert of the vehicle tire. The end sections of the cut material web can be clamped in a splicing device with pairs of upper and lower splicing elements, which can be displaced in relation to one another and the sections can be butt spliced. One end section of the cut material web is laid and fixed on one splicing element of the pair of splicing elements and a base part that supports the pair of splicing elements is rotated through 360°, during the feeding of the material web, until the second end section of the looped material web is positioned and fixed in the vicinity of the first end section and on the same plane as the latter on the second splicing element of the pair of splicing elements and finally the sections are joined in a butt splice by the horizontal displacement of the pair of upper and lower splicing elements towards one another.

    • A pneumatic tire for a vehicle has a casing that extends over the periphery of the tire, a belt that extends radially on the outside of the casing over the entire periphery of the tire and in an axial direction over at least the width of the pneumatic tire. The belt is made of one or several belt plies with rigid supports which are embodied diagonally in the direction of the periphery of the tire and are embedded in a parallel manner in the rubber or plastic material. A bandage extends radially on the outside of the belt over the periphery of the tire. One or several parallel reinforcement supports are wound about the external belt position which is constructed on the construction body in a helical or spiral-shape in the axial direction of the construction body which is oriented, substantially, in the direction of the periphery which is constructed on a pivotable, rotationally-symmetrical construction body which is radial to the outer belt position of the belt in order to produce the bandage. The bandage strip construction material which is made of thread-like reinforcements and/or strip-like bands are guided to the construction body by one or several parallel rigid supports having at least four supply devices which can be moved in relation to the relative position thereof to the construction body and by controlled rotation of the construction body and controlled axial modification of the relative position between the construction body and the supply devices in order to wind on the belt about the belt helically or spirally.
